Title: INVESTIGATION ON FLEXURAL BEHAVIORS OF I-SHAPED JOINTED COMPOSITE PLATES

Abstract: In this study, the flexural behaviors of a composite plate jointed with I profile jointing element have been carried out experimentally and numerically. As a load type, four point flexural tests have been used in order to study performances of jointed composite plates under bending load. The effects of jointing geometry parameters ratio of the width of lock to width of semi-specimen (b/W), lock middle/end width to the width of lock (z/b) and the length of lock to the width of semi-specimen (h/2W) have been investigated. According to the investigation optimum jointing parameters have been found with the h/2w ratio of 0.5, b/w ratio of 0.5 and z/b ratio of 0.5. Abaqus 6.11 finite element program has been used in order to support the results obtained from the experiments. Damages have been mostly seen on jointing lock elements.
